I wasn't sure what forum to post this in. But seeing how it has to do with giving out free css code, I figured this might be best.

Anyway, I have designed a bunch of css content boxes that I am giving away on my website for free. I wanted to include some type of license that allows people to do anything with the code except re-distribute it on their own website.

I don't care if they use it as part of some type of opensource script or anything. I just don't want someone else downloading my stuff and giving it away on their website without changing it.

Any suggestions?
